  • Patent number: 11518914
    Abstract: The present disclosure relates to a pressure sensitive adhesive assembly comprising at least a first pressure sensitive adhesive layer comprising a hollow non-porous particulate filler material, wherein the surface of the hollow non-porous particulate filler material is provided with a hydrophobic surface modification. The present disclosure also relates to a method of manufacturing such a pressure sensitive adhesive assembly.

  • Patent number: 11332648
    Abstract: The present disclosure relates to a pressure sensitive adhesive assembly suitable for bonding to a substrate provided with an uneven surface, wherein the pressure sensitive adhesive assembly comprises a polymeric foam layer comprising a polymeric base material and a particulate filler material comprising a thermoplastic material, and wherein the polymeric foam layer has a complex viscosity comprised between 2,000 Pa·s to 80,000 Pa·s, when measured at 120 C according to the test method described in the experimental section. The present disclosure is also directed to a method of applying a pressure sensitive adhesive assembly to a substrate provided with an uneven surface, and uses thereof.

  • Publication number: 20180312734
    Abstract: The present disclosure is directed to a curable precursor of a pressure-sensitive adhesive comprising: a) a (co)polymeric material comprising the reaction product of a (co)polymerizable material comprising a (meth)acrylate ester monomer; and optionally, a co-monomer having an ethylenically unsaturated group; b) a polyfunctional aziridine curing agent; c) a thermal acid generating agent; and d) magnetic particles. The present disclosure is also directed to a method of applying such pressure-sensitive adhesives to a substrate and uses thereof.

  • Publication number: 20180080586
    Abstract: A multilayer hollow body has the following layers: I. an inner layer (layer I) containing a moulding composition based on PA612, PA610, PA1010, PA1012 and/or PA1212 and copolymers thereof and mixtures thereof; II. optionally an adhesion promoter layer (layer II) containing a moulding composition based on the following components: a) 0 to 80 parts by weight of a polyamide selected from PA6, PA66, PA6/66 and mixtures thereof, b) 0 to 100 parts by weight of a polyamine-polyamide copolymer and c) 0 to 80 parts by weight of a polyamide selected from PA11, PA12, PA612, PA1010, PA1012, PA1212 and mixtures thereof, where the sum total of the parts by weight of components a), b) and c) is 100; III. a layer (layer III) containing an ethylene-vinyl alcohol copolymer moulding composition is executed in such a way that not more than 0.2 g/m2 of insoluble extract and not more than 7.
